Design review: 106 Eighteenth cleared to proceed to permitting; 1303 Gulf Way returned for revisions

Staff and applicants resolved outstanding issues for 106 Eighteenth Avenue and the board allowed staff to proceed to permitting; design review for 1303 Gulf Way remains incomplete after staff and the consultant flagged frontage, fenestration and ground-floor treatment concerns.

The board discussed two design-review items on March 6: 106 Eighteenth Avenue (case 25034) and 1303 Gulf Way (case 24095).

106 Eighteenth Avenue: Planning staff and the applicant reported the project meets house-medium standards with an alley-access garage and an existing curb cut to be closed on the east.
